She Held Her Honor



She held her honor
   in my hands
And I was willing
To be frank with her
Upended
   monstrous
      sense
Of value
Sent to me
   for soft deflowered
Presence
   left in essence
And empowered with the seeds
   of lust
And breaded trust
   that crunched
      with salty flavor
Savored by my
   yearning tongue
That spoke with
   fluent language
Smooth with spiked romance
That I would dance
And prance with macho pride
That bloomed
In simple trances
Flayed with chances
Taken
And forsaken in the fogs 
And mists
Incensed
   by musty rivers
      held in slivers
Of enlightened
   revelry
